Bonsai vs heat from fireplace!!! HELP!

Changing of seasons here in Colorado. I have/had a very happy little Bonsai whom I've been friends with and caregiving for years now. While I was out, my wonderful boyfriend made the first fire of the year.....and he did not move little Bonsai which was in the window a few feet away. I came home to its poor leaves curling from the heat. Over the next three days all of his leaves fell off. I love this Bonsai - do I prune? Is he ...(gulp) dead? I would sure appreciate any advice.....Thank you. :cry:

welcome to the forum, fellow Coloradan. I think only time will tell if your plant will pull through. It looks like a fig, which are pretty good at bouncing back from abuse, so it should be fine. I wouldn't take any actions except make sure you don't overwater, since without leaves your bonsai will not be using much. And keep it well away from heat sources.
